ArmInfo.The meeting of the leader of the opposition movement "Take a step", the candidate from the people for the post of Prime Minister of Armenia Nikol Pashinyan with the head of the parliamentary faction of the Republican Party of Armenia (RPA) Vahram Baghdasaryan is over. According to Pashinyan, the RPA is predisposed not to hinder the election of a candidate from the people for the premiership at the NA session on May 1.
According to the opposition, during the meeting the parties agreed to organize a meeting with the RPA faction in an expanded format. The meeting is likely to take place on the 29th or 30th of April. Answering the remark that even with the provision of votes from other parliamentary factions, Pashinyan will need to get the support of another 6 votes of the RPA deputies for election, he said: "If there is a predisposition not to impede the voting, they (RPA) will discuss and make a decision that will not be directed against the election of the People's Prime Minister. "
Meanwhile, after the meeting, answering journalists' question about how the Republican Party will vote on May 1 at the parliament session, Vahram Baghdasaryan stated that he will refrain from answering this question before holding the RPA meeting.
